Makes 2 pies

2 cups buttermilk
1/2 tsp. salt
1 tsp. vanilla
4 eggs, separated
1 1/2 cups sugar
4 Tbsp. flour
1 stick oleo

Directions:
Directions:
Have oleo at room temperature. Mix salt, sugar, flour, with buttermilk, oleo and egg yolks. Add beaten egg whites and vanilla. Bake for 20 minutes at 375 degrees reduce temperature to 350 degrees and bake 25 minutes.
